    The Johnson County Sheriff's Office runs the jails at Olathe and New Century, [45] and patrols the unincorporated parts of Johnson County as well as the cities of Edgerton and DeSoto. [46] In 2019, the county announced that it is creating a new task force with shared jurisdiction between neighboring Miami and Franklin counties to combat crime. [47]

    The Leawood Police Department is the main department in the city of Leawood, the Johnson County Sheriff's Office also assists as well. The Leawood Police Department was formed on January 18, 1949. The agency was formed when Robert E. Combs became the city's first chief of police.
